Do you ever feel tempted to check out from your responsibilities as the holiday season approaches? Today on My Morning Devotional, Richelle Alessi explores how we can finish the year strong by staying diligent—not letting our work and tasks slip away amidst the busyness of gift giving, travel, and celebrations. Together, we'll discover biblical encouragement from Colossians 3:23 and practical ways to embrace our responsibilities as blessings, setting ourselves up to fully enjoy the holidays and start 2026 on a high note.

Today I want to talk about getting things done and not checking out. I know most of us listening probably have a job. During this season. It is so easy to start checking out from the things that we want to get done because we truly are so focused on family, on gift giving, on gift buying, on family coming into town or going out of town to see family. And this is the season for that. It really, really is. But there's also a season that we cannot ignore and a part of our lives that we cannot ignore. And that is our responsibilities, the work, and everything that's still waiting for us. And even though that's not the most fun subject to talk about, it is such a big part of our life. And so how about part of finishing our year strong is staying diligent and not drifting for the important things.

00:02:11.449 --> 00:02:37.590
Because the way that we finish will allow us to truly enjoy our holiday season. The way that we finish will truly help us fully check out when we get to check out and truly enjoy that time without having our minds full with the little things that are still pending that we didn't finish or we could have finished and we did not fully give it our attention.
